The young adult who are generally impacted by AIDS are the foundation of the labor force. They are also likely to have young children who may be orphaned if both parents become infected, or may be infected themselves if there mother unknowingly carried the virus in utero.

At the same time, drugs which are now available to keep people alive longer are generally not accessible to people in poor countries. The drug cocktails that have slowed the death rate in the United States cost literally thousands of dollars each month. Some of the developing countries have countered by manufacturing generic drugs off of the drug companies patents that are available for much lower costs. However, they are being fought by the major drug companies, with great pressure brought to bear on them.
